This document compares Cisco StackWise and Virtual Switching System (VSS) technologies. StackWise allows stacking of switches to be managed as one logical switch. Up to 9 switches can stack through a special cable. VSS also logically combines two switches into one virtual device through a port-channel link called the Virtual Switch Link (VSL).
